例如:ALTER TABLE customer ADD COLUMN normalized_phone VARCHAR(20) GENERATED ALWAYS AS (REPLACE(phone, ' ', '')) STORED; CREATE INDEX idx_normalized_phone ON customer (normalized_phone);然后查询就可以变为:SELECT * FROM customer WHERE normalized_phone LIKE '%803222222%';这里normalized_phone是一个生成列,它会存储phone字段去除空格后的值,并且可以为其创建索引。
它的核心特性是允许动态添加属性。
禁用分块传输编码的实践方法 根据上述机制,要禁用Go net/http服务器的chunked传输编码,并强制使用identity传输(即通过Content-Length指定内容长度),唯一的有效方法是在写入响应体之前,显式地设置Content-Length头部。
可以通过递归或迭代的方式实现。
使用image/jpeg.Encode或image/png.Encode等编码器将处理后的图片写入新的文件。
实际操作中,你需要根据WSDL文件中定义的具体服务名称、方法名和参数结构来调整。
最常见的用法是 json: 标签,用于指定字段在 JSON 中的名称。
示例: $handler = new RequestHandler(); $handler(); 常用于闭包替代方案 __clone():对象克隆控制 使用 clone 关键字复制对象时,__clone() 会被调用。
注意:imagefill() 是从一个点开始向外填充的,所以通常会从 (0,0) 开始。
#include <iostream> void testScope() { static int localStaticVar = 100; std::cout << "Inside testScope: " << localStaticVar << std::endl; } // int main() { // std::cout << localStaticVar << std::endl; // 编译错误:'localStaticVar' was not declared in this scope // return 0; // }这段代码清晰地展示了局部静态变量的块作用域。
任何细微的差别(如toString()、String(s string))都将导致fmt包无法自动识别和调用。
虽然不如格式化函数灵活,但足够直观易用,适合初学者和日常编程使用。
立即学习“PHP免费学习笔记(深入)”; 前端使用JavaScript(如File API)按固定大小(如5MB/片)切分文件 每片独立上传,携带序号、文件唯一标识等元数据 服务端接收后暂存分片,记录状态,避免重复上传 所有分片上传完成后,服务端合并文件并验证完整性 这种方式即使网络中断,也只需重传未完成的片段。
基本比较操作符 Go 支持常见的比较操作,结果为 true 或 false: ==:等于 !=:不等于 <:小于 <=:小于等于 >:大于 >=:大于等于 这些操作可用于数字、字符串(按字典序比较)等类型。
最佳实践与总结 在Go语言中,对于Map这种引用类型,绝大多数情况下,直接按值传递Map是正确的、惯用的且高效的选择。
加权轮询/随机:根据节点配置权重分配流量,适用于异构服务器。
读锁使用 RLock() 和 RUnlock(),写锁仍用 Lock()/Unlock()。
临时文件清理:PHP通常会自动清理上传的临时文件。
下面是一些实用的注意点。
这种自定义的能力,让它在面对复杂业务逻辑时也能游刃有余。
本文链接:http://www.theyalibrarian.com/420612_515592.html